#3d4f89 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3d4f89 is composed of 23.9% red, 31%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.5% cyan, 42.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 225.8 degrees, a saturation of 38.4% and a lightness of 38.8%. #3d4f89 color hex could be obtained by blending #7a9eff with #000013.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#3d4f89

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f3f4f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#3d4f89

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b5f6b is the less saturated color, while #002fc6 is the most saturated one.
